West Port Timber Windows, Doors & Fire Doorsets is seeking a full-time Area Sales Manager for the Southeast and London Area. The role offers a hybrid working model, combining office hours with occasional work from home.
Responsibilities include:
- Generating leads
- Managing a client portfolio
- Preparing proposals
Applicants should have:
- Proven sales experience
- Strong negotiation skills
- A solid understanding of the timber or construction industry
This position involves regular travel to meet clients and represent the company at industry events.

How to prepare for a job interview at West Port Timber Windows, Doors & Fire Doorsets
✨Know Your Timber
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of timber products, especially windows, doors, and fire doorsets. Understanding the specifics of what West Port Timber offers will not only impress your interviewers but also help you answer questions more confidently.
✨Showcase Your Sales Success
Prepare to discuss your previous sales achievements in detail. Bring specific examples of how you've generated leads and managed client portfolios. Use metrics to back up your claims, as numbers speak volumes in sales roles.
✨Master the Art of Negotiation
Since strong negotiation skills are a must for this role, think of scenarios where you successfully negotiated deals. Be ready to explain your approach and the outcomes, demonstrating your ability to close sales effectively.
✨Plan for Travel and Events
As the role involves regular travel and attending industry events, be prepared to discuss your experience with this. Highlight any relevant experiences that show your adaptability and enthusiasm for meeting clients face-to-face.
